ABSTRACT
Microservices are replacing monolithic applications by splitting them out into small and independent artifacts that collaborate with one another. Focused on managing highly cohesive information, microservices may be composed to provide richer and linked information. This paper presents a composition method, aimed at composing semantic microservices for achieving data integration based on Linked Data principles. Moreover, the proposed method leverages the independence of development and composability of microservices. This paper also presents a framework and a case study for the proposed method.
- S. Araujo, A. de Vries, and D. Schwabe. SERIMI Results for OAEI 2011. In Proceedings of the 6th International Conference on Ontology Matching. CEUR-WS.org, 2011. Google ScholarDigital Library
- R. Battle and E. Benson. Bridging the semantic Web and Web 2.0 with Representational State Transfer (REST). Web Semantics, 6(1):61--69, Feb. 2008. Google ScholarDigital Library
- T. Berners-Lee, J. Hendler, and O. Lassila. The Semantic Web. Scientific American, 284(5):34--43, May 2001.Google ScholarCross Ref
- C. Bizer, T. Heath, K. Idehen, and T. Berners-Lee. Linked data on the web (ldow2008). In Proceedings of the 17th International Conference on World Wide Web, WWW '08, pages 1265--1266, New York, NY, USA, 2008. ACM. Google ScholarDigital Library
- M. A. Casanova, V. M. P. Vidal, G. R. Lopes, L. A. P. P. Leme, and L. Ruback. On Materialized sameAs Linksets. In Database and Expert Systems Applications: 25th International Conference, pages 377--384. Springer International Publishing, 2014.Google ScholarCross Ref
- A. K. Elmagarmid, P. G. Ipeirotis, and V. S. Verykios. Duplicate record detection: A survey. IEEE Transactions on Knowledge and Data Engineering, 19(1):1--16, Jan. 2007. Google ScholarDigital Library
- J. Euzenat and P. Shvaiko. Ontology Matching. Springer-Verlag New York, Inc., Secaucus, NJ, USA, 2007. Google ScholarDigital Library
- A. Ferrara, A. Nikolov, and F. Scharffe. Data Linking for the Semantic Web. International Journal on Semantic Web and Information Systems, 7(3):46--76, Jan. 2011. Google ScholarDigital Library
- R. T. Fielding. Architectural Styles and the Design of Network-based Software Architectures. PhD thesis, University of California, Irvine, 2000. Google ScholarDigital Library
- T. Heath and C. Bizer. Linked data: Evolving the web into a global data space. Morgan & Claypool Publishers, 2011. Google ScholarDigital Library
- W. Hu, J. Chen, and Y. Qu. A self-training approach for resolving object coreference on the semantic web. In Proceedings of the 20th international conference on World wide web - WWW '11, page 87, New York, New York, USA, 2011. ACM Press. Google ScholarDigital Library
- W. Hu and C. Jia. A bootstrapping approach to entity linkage on the Semantic Web. Web Semantics: Science, Services and Agents on the World Wide Web, 34:1--12, Oct. 2015. Google ScholarDigital Library
- N. Islam, A. Z. Abbasi, and Z. a. Shaikh. Semantic web: Choosing the right methodologies, tools and standards. In 2010 International Conference on Information and Emerging Technologies, ICIET 2010, pages 1--5. IEEE, June 2010.Google ScholarCross Ref
- H. Köpcke and E. Rahm. Frameworks for entity matching: A comparison. Data Knowl. Eng., 69(2):197--210, Feb. 2010. Google ScholarDigital Library
- M. Lanthaler and C. Gütl. On Using JSON-LD to Create Evolvable RESTful Services. In Proceedings of the Third International Workshop on RESTful Design, WS-REST '12, pages 25--32, New York, NY, USA, 2012. ACM. Google ScholarDigital Library
- R. P. Magalhães, J. M. Monteiro, V. M. P. Vidal, J. A. F. de Macêdo, M. Maia, F. Porto, and M. a. Casanova. QEF-LD - A Query Engine for Distributed Query Processing on Linked Data. In Proceedings of the 15th International Conference on Enterprise Information Systems, pages 185--192. SciTePress, 2013.Google Scholar
- J. P. Martin-Flatin and W. Löwe. Special Issue on Recent Advances in Web Services. World Wide Web, 10(3):205--209, Aug. 2007. Google ScholarDigital Library
- S. McIlraith, T. Son, and H. Z. H. Zeng. Semantic Web services. IEEE Intelligent Systems, 16(2):46--53, Mar. 2001. Google ScholarDigital Library
- S. Newman. Building Microservices. O'Reilly Media, Gravenstein Highway North, Sebastopol, CA. USA, 2015. Google ScholarDigital Library
- L. Otero-Cerdeira, F. J. Rodríguez-Martínez, and A. Gómez-Rodríguez. Ontology matching: A literature review. Expert Systems with Applications, 42(2):949--971, 2015. Google ScholarDigital Library
- M. Richards. Microservices vs. Service-Oriented Architecture. O'Reilly Media, Inc., 1005 Gravenstein Highway North, Sebastopol, CA 95472. O'Reilly, 2015.Google Scholar
- H. Stoermer, N. Rassadko, and N. Vaidya. Feature-based entity matching: The fbem model, implementation, evaluation. In Proceedings of the 22Nd International Conference on Advanced Information Systems Engineering, CAiSE'10, pages 180--193, Berlin, Heidelberg, 2010. Springer-Verlag. Google ScholarDigital Library
Index Terms
- Publishing linked data through semantic microservices composition
Recommendations
An ontology alignment framework for data-driven microservices
iiWAS '17: Proceedings of the 19th International Conference on Information Integration and Web-based Applications & ServicesThe integration of heterogeneous data sources can be done by using data-driven microservices along with Semantic Web technologies. However, it becomes a challenge in cross-domain scenarios, in which data is described by heterogeneous ontologies. This ...
Using the relation ontology Metarel for modelling Linked Data as multi-digraphs
Linked Data for Health Care and the Life SciencesThe Semantic Web standards OWL and RDF are often used to represent biomedical information as Linked Data; however, the OWL/RDF syntax, which combines both, was never optimised for querying. By combining two formal paradigms for modelling Linked Data, ...
Publishing a Disease Ontologies as Linked Data
Semantic TechnologyAbstractPublishing open data as linked data is a significant trend in not only the Semantic Web community but also other domains such as life science, government, media, geographic research and publication. One feature of linked data is the instance-...
Comments